Is NextEra Power Inventory a Purchase?

Published

on

An image of a rocket ship jumping up stairs.

NextEra Power (NYSE: NEE) has a dividend yield of round 2.7% at present. Revenue buyers and people with a worth bias most likely will not need to purchase its shares, however in the event you like dividend progress shares, the ten% annualized payout progress NextEra Power has achieved over the previous decade will most likely get your juices flowing.

And if administration is correct, the longer term appears simply nearly as good because the previous for dividend progress.

Why some folks will not like NextEra Power

NextEra Power has one main downside: Wall Road is aware of that this can be a very well-run utility. That is why the yield is 2.7%, which is under the three% common for , utilizing the Vanguard Utilities Index ETF (NYSEMKT: VPU) as a proxy.

Positive, NextEra yields greater than the 1.3% you’ll get from an S&P 500 Index fund, but it surely simply is not a excessive yield inventory. Dividend buyers and people with a worth bias — noting that the yield is at finest center of the highway over the previous decade — will most likely need to have a look at utilities with larger yields.

Picture supply: Getty Pictures.

That stated, the present dividend yield is not the explanation to purchase NextEra Power. Dividend progress is the actual story, with the dividend rising by greater than 180% over the previous 10 years.

The inventory has risen by virtually the very same quantity over that span, as nicely, resulting in a fairly spectacular whole return of greater than 260%, with dividend reinvestment. That is higher than , which had a complete return of round 225% over the identical span. Step again for a second: NextEra, a utility firm, beat the S&P 500!

NEE Chart

However there’s one other determine that you simply may discover attention-grabbing: yield on buy value. If you happen to purchased NextEra Power in 2013 at its costliest level, you’ll have paid $22.4375 per share, adjusted for a 4-for-1 inventory break up in 2020. The annualized dividend within the fourth quarter of 2013 was $0.66 per share, for a yield on buy of roughly 2.9%.

On the finish of the second quarter of 2024, the annualized dividend was $2.06 per share, which might imply your yield primarily based on buy value rose to an enormous 9.2% or so in a bit over a decade. If you happen to like dividend progress, you may love NextEra Power.

The longer term appears shiny for NextEra Power

NextEra Power has achieved this dividend progress by constructing a big renewable energy enterprise atop its regulated utility operations in Florida. Clearly the enterprise mannequin has labored nicely primarily based on the dividend progress.

And NextEra thinks the following few years can be simply nearly as good because the final decade. Proper now, the corporate is asking for earnings progress of between 6% and eight% a yr by a minimum of 2027. That may result in dividend progress of 10% a yr by a minimum of 2026.

What’s backing that outlook? Administration expects electrical energy demand in america, pushed by demand for renewable energy, to extend materially within the years forward.

Some numbers will assist: Between 2000 and 2020, electrical energy demand expanded simply 9%, however between 2020 and 2040, NextEra believes demand will enhance by 38%. That is a drastic change in what has traditionally been thought of a fairly sleepy sector.

However the actually vital a part of the story right here is that NextEra Power’s clear vitality experience, constructed over many years, positions it nicely to learn from the push for renewable energy that it expects. And in the event you purchase NextEra at present, you possibly can profit together with the corporate.

NextEra Power is all the time costly

If you happen to purchased the inventory in 2013 when it had a 2.9% dividend yield, you’ll most likely be a fairly comfortable dividend-growth investor at present. However that yield is fairly near the two.7% yield at present, which means that NextEra Power has been an costly inventory to personal for a really very long time. Nevertheless, if dividend progress is what you might be after, this utility has proved that paying up for high quality can work out very nicely over the long run.

Traders must be hesitant to dive into shares after the speed reduce, with election uncertainty looming, Fundstrat's Tom Lee says

Published

on

Cindy Ord/Getty Photographs for Yahoo; iStock; Rebecca Zisser/BI

  • Tom Lee has lengthy referred to as for a inventory market rally after the Federal Reserve cuts rates of interest.

  • However after Wednesday’s massive 50 foundation level reduce, Lee says he sees uncertainty looming forward of the election.

  • Different analysts have additionally warned of volatility main as much as the November vote.

Outstanding inventory market bull Tom Lee has lengthy referred to as for a giant rally after the Federal Reserve cuts rates of interest.

However after a giant 50 foundation level reduce on Wednesday, Lee says he is feeling cautious forward of the November election.

“This Fed reduce cycle I believe is setting the stage for markets to be actually sturdy over the subsequent one month or subsequent three months,” Lee, co-founder and head of analysis at Fundstrat International Advisors, instructed CNBC in a Thursday interview.

“However, what the shares do between now and for example election day, I believe remains to be numerous uncertainty. And that is the rationale why I am slightly hesitant for traders to dive in,” he added.

Within the days main as much as the Fed’s coverage assembly, Lee mentioned a price reduce would , bolstered by additional confidence that extra price cuts are on the horizon and {that a} tender touchdown is within the playing cards.

That rally would occur no matter a 25 or 50 foundation level reduce, he mentioned, if the Fed urged future cuts are seemingly. Even then, although, Lee acknowledged there can be volatility main as much as the election, however would relax afterward for a powerful yr forward.

Lee has been bullish on shares for years, with predictions that the S&P 500 may triple, hitting .

Different analysts have additionally acknowledged the market volatility related to presidential elections.

That volatility forward of the elections in November, after which shares see a aid rally as soon as the end result is understood, SoFi’s Liz Younger Thomas instructed Enterprise Insider earlier this month.

With election-related volatility forward, Lee recommends investing in cyclical shares in areas like industrials, financials, and small caps.

Small-cap shares, specifically, will profit from price cuts and what Lee calls a “cyclical enhance to the economic system,” which can consequence from a drop in shoppers’ prices like mortgages, auto loans, and bank cards.

“All these are massive tailwinds for small caps,” he mentioned.

Nike veteran Hill to exchange Donahoe as CEO; shares soar

Published

on

© Reuters. FILE PHOTO: A Nike Air Jordan sneaker is seen on display at the newly renovated JD Sports store at Westfield Stratford City in London, Britain, July 30, 2024. REUTERS/Hollie Adams/File Photo

By Juveria Tabassum, Nicholas P. Brown

(Reuters) -Nike mentioned on Thursday that former senior government Elliott Hill will rejoin the corporate to succeed John Donahoe as president and CEO, because the sportswear large shakes up its management amid efforts to revive gross sales and battle rising competitors.

The corporate’s shares rose 8% in after-hours buying and selling.

Hill was at Nike (NYSE:) for 32 years and held senior management positions throughout Europe and North America the place he helped broaden the enterprise to greater than $39 billion, the corporate mentioned.

He was beforehand Nike’s president, client market, main all business and market operations for the Nike and Jordan manufacturers earlier than retiring in 2020.

Nike mentioned in a regulatory submitting that Hill’s compensation as president and CEO will embrace an annual base wage of $1.5 million. He’ll take over as CEO on Oct. 14.

Analysts cheered the transfer. The CEO change “offers a optimistic sign as a result of it’s somebody that is aware of the model and is aware of the corporate very nicely,” mentioned Jessica Ramirez of Jane Hali & Associates.

Donahoe was tasked with bolstering Nike’s on-line presence and driving gross sales by means of direct-to-consumer channels.

The push initially helped the corporate construct on the demand for athletic and leisurewear following the pandemic, leading to Nike exceeding $50 billion in annual gross sales in fiscal 2023 for the primary time.

Nevertheless, gross sales have since come beneath strain and development has slowed, in keeping with estimates compiled by LSEG. Nike’s annual gross sales are anticipated to fall to $48.84 billion for fiscal 2025 as inflation-weary prospects in the reduction of on discretionary spending and China’s market rebounds extra slowly than anticipated. 

A scarcity of revolutionary and interesting merchandise has additionally not too long ago tripped demand for Nike. Rival manufacturers together with Roger Federer-backed On and Deckers’ Hoka are attracting customers and retail companions with sneakers thought-about extra trendy and classy.

Expectations for a change on the prime had been heightened after billionaire investor William Ackman disclosed a stake in Nike. His Pershing Sq. Capital Administration has continued to purchase and now owns 16.3 million shares in Nike, an individual accustomed to the place mentioned. Ackman was not instantly reachable for remark.

An individual accustomed to Ackman’s pondering mentioned that Hill would have been his best choice to exchange Donahoe. Ackman, who introduced his Nike stake through a public submitting, had not been in contact with the corporate. 

Just lately the company boards of a minimum of two different client and retail corporations have moved to toss prime executives earlier than activist traders informed them to behave.

Hill’s background as a former steward of Nike’s useful Jordan model, a significant profit-driver for the corporate, might additionally assist the sportswear large regain some momentum. The worth of some Jordan footwear in 2023 had been slipping on the resale market as different sneaker manufacturers, together with On Operating, skilled meteoric development.

Within the final couple of years, Nike had curtailed partnerships with retailers and pushed forward with its plan to drive extra gross sales by means of its personal shops and web sites. These gross sales didn’t materialize and put the corporate on a path to hunt $2 billion in value financial savings over three years. 

As a part of the plan, Nike has to this point lower jobs, decreased provide of basic footwear such because the Air Pressure 1 and tried to enhance provide chain to spice up margins.  

“It clearly appears like Nike wished to deliver again any person with quite a lot of expertise” and “deep information of Nike and its points – not like John Donahoe, who got here in with none expertise within the business,” mentioned David Swartz, senior analyst at  Morningstar Analysis.

Hill must “work on repairing a few of Nike’s relationships” with retail companions who purchase Nike footwear at wholesale, Swartz added. “Nike has dropped some prospects through the years and pulled again some product and that has created some in poor health will in direction of Nike” amongst sneaker and footwear retailers, he mentioned. 

Thomas Hayes, chairman at Nice Hill Capital, known as Hill a “nice choose.” Nike now must “innovate and restore relationships with wholesalers,” he added. Nice Hill Capital doesn’t maintain shares in Nike.

Born in Austin, Texas, Hill began his Nike profession as an assistant within the Memphis, Tennessee, showroom and was quickly promoted to a gross sales place, figuring out of the Dallas workplace and calling on mom-and-pop sporting items shops.

“I had samples with me, and I might name, make appointments, present up on the sporting items retailer and current the road,” Hill mentioned in a December 2023 podcast interview. “I made unbelievable relationships with a few of these folks. Even at the moment, I nonetheless be in contact with a number of of these retailers.” He finally moved into serving to to launch new Nike merchandise.

Nike’s inventory market worth elevated by $11 billion in prolonged commerce on Thursday following the CEO announcement.

Why Intuitive Machines Inventory Rocketed 24% Skyward on Thursday

Published

on

The inventory of house exploration firm Intuitive Machines (NASDAQ: LUNR) strongly defied gravity on Thursday. It closed the day greater than 24% greater, thanks in no small half to information of a significant price-target enhance from an analyst. That transfer got here mere days after the corporate delivered a number of the greatest information it is ever reported.

Over the moon about NASA’s moon contract

The elevate was enacted by B. Riley‘s Mike Crawford, who now feels a good worth estimation for Intuitive Machines must be significantly greater. He raised his by 50%, to $12 per share from the earlier $8, and maintained the present purchase suggestion. The brand new anticipates upside of 29% on the inventory’s most up-to-date shut.

It is not arduous to be glowingly bullish on Intuitive Machines as of late. On Tuesday, the corporate was chosen by the Nationwide Aeronautics and Area Administration (NASA) as the only enterprise to ascertain a between our planet and the moon.

Within the grand custom of main federal contracts, this one is doubtlessly value fairly a little bit of coin. All instructed the association, which will likely be in pressure for 5 years with an possibility to increase to 10, may pay out as a lot as $4.8 billion for the stipulated providers.

A shock solo choice

Crawford didn’t anticipate Intuitive Machines could be the one winner of the contract; he anticipated one or two different suppliers would even be chosen for the NASA venture. This added to his impression that the formidable firm “is shortly establishing itself as a full-service house exploration firm on the cusp of layering in a whole bunch of thousands and thousands of {dollars} of high-margin providers income, enabling an extended tail of sturdy free money move technology.”
